  • Abstract
    Summary form only given. In this contribution silica-based rare earth-doped double-clad fiber lasers are described, which are developed for laser operation at high output powers and efficiencies. By applying optimized fiber architectures and mode-scrambler devices output powers of approximately cw 10 W in single-transverse-mode operation are observed for neodymium-doped double-clad fibers.
